How Much Does Tree Removal Cost in South Bradenton?

Tree removal costs vary based on several factors including tree size, convenience and security of access, and the number of trees that need to be removed. In South Bradenton, homeowners pay around $536 for tree removal services, with prices running from $207 to $846.

Emergency tree removal is necessary in some instances, such as when a powerful storm partially pulls up a tree near your home. Property owners in South Bradenton pay an average of $800 for emergency tree removal.

Signs That a Tree Needs to Be Removed

Older trees, which are common in South Bradenton, are more susceptible to disease, general wear and tear, and damage. You may need these trees removed if you discover:

  • Cracking between branches , especially large heavy ones
  • Rot , dead branches , missing bark or leaves , and other signs of decay
  • Cracks in the trunk , especially deep cracks
  • The trunk branches off in different directions into multiple large , heavy branches
  • Fungus or mold

If you see that a tree is leaning or that there is raised dirt around the base, have the tree evaluated immediately, as it is at a higher risk of falling. If a tree is nearing your house or utility lines, you may also need an evaluation, as numerous neighborhoods and utility companies have specific policies for tree proximity.

Do Tree Removal Companies Need to be Licensed in Florida?

Florida does not have specific licensing requirements for tree removal companies, but it’s important to check with your local municipal government to ensure your provider meets the requirements in your area. Opt for a reputable business that carries workers compensation and liability insurance. For additional peace of mind, hire a licensed contractor who provides tree removal services. An individual can also become a licensed arborist through the International Society of Arboriculture (ISA). While not required, this certification indicates that an individual is trained in all aspects of arboriculture and follows the ISA’s code of ethics. You can search for a licensed arborist or verify credentials on the ISA’s search tool.

Ways you can keep your trees healthy include periodically pruning overgrown or dead branches, keeping heavy lawn equipment or vehicles off the roots, and topping up soil around the base if it starts to diminish. Consider pest control services if insects are damaging your trees.
